The charity Working Families helps parents, carers and their advisors with all of their questions on their rights at work.
Parents, carers and their advisors can contact the Working Families Helpline on 0300 012 0312 for free advice and support. The Helpline can also be contacted by emailing advice@workingfamilies.org.uk.
The Helpline Team is happy to answer queries on areas including
- maternity and paternity leave and pay; shared parental leave
- maternity discrimination
- parental leave
- time off for family emergencies
- the right to request flexible working
- in-work benefits
